Bartlett, TN to Unicoi, TN is 490.2 miles and takes about 9h 1m via I 40 and I 81, with a fuel budget near $87 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This drive stays within Tennessee, connecting the western part of the state to the eastern edge. Given the 9-hour duration, it's a trip best suited for an overnight stay, allowing you to break up the driving. The route offers a mix of interstate cruising and surface road travel. Consider this if you're looking for a direct path across Tennessee.

With a total drive time of just over 9 hours, this trip is comfortably split over two days. Plan to leave Bartlett in the morning and drive for about 4-5 hours, aiming for a stop around the halfway point. The longest uninterrupted stretch is 210.5 miles on I 40, so be sure to fuel up before you begin that segment. Keep an eye on your fuel gauge, as the estimated cost is $87, and stops might be less frequent on the highway sections. Two planned stops are recommended to make the drive more manageable.

Seasonal Notes
Summer travel usually means heavier construction, hotter rest stops, and busier weekend traffic around major cities.
Winter travel shortens daylight, so a route that looks manageable on paper can feel much longer after dark.
Holiday weekends tend to make both departure and arrival windows slower than the raw route time suggests.
For long drives, weather on day two can matter just as much as conditions at departure, so check the whole travel window rather than only the first day.

Bartlett is a city in metropolitan Memphis, Tennessee. It has several buildings of historic interest, and a walkable Historic District". In 2018, the population of Bartlett was almost 60,000. The Trail of Tears runs along Stage Road through the city. It commemorates the forced relocations between 1830 and 1850 of approximately 60,000 Native Americans from their ancestral homelands in the Southeastern U.S. to areas west of the Mississippi River that had been designated as Indian Territory.
